Interaction takes place between viewer and image by means of a projective imagination.

The work finalklein by Susanne Schuricht shows a surface divided into equal rectangles. Each rectangle displays
the same film sequence. finalklein is a minimalist drama with one hand, one film, and asynchronously playing
sequences of that film which means that each individual film sequence begins marginally earlier or later than the
others. At first unrecognizable, then not dissimilar to a muscle. The paths of movement converge - eventually
focusing the synchronous movement. What once looked like a kaleidoscope is consolidating
into a composite image,
going back to its original: moving hands and fingers.

The full span is covered, with various interpretive possibilities and a dramaturgical climax – from the clear
recognition of the hands and fingers to their dissolution into an abstract pattern. As the film continues the
impressions start to merge, constituting an organism like configuration. In the Web version, the browser is
determining the pattern of the movie. (Wolf Guenter Thiel)
